C-23828 Eischen National Review and Concurrence
National Arbitrator Eischen decides that Review and Concurrence is a Due Process Right that requires two separate judgments prior to issuing a suspension or discharge. Each official must perform an independent and substantive review of the record. Violations require that Regional Arbitrators disregard the merits and overturn the discipline with a make whole remedy.
